On the Wings of the Wind: A Journey to Faith by Patricia Eytcheson Taylor and the Rev. James C. Taylor was released about a year and a half ago. I announced the release of the book, but I hadn’t started interviewing authors on my blog at that time.
Although the book isn’t new, it is very timely now. In difficult times, many people seek a closer relationship with the Lord. The Taylors’ book is a guide to do that. Pat shares her spiritual journey from her despair at the death of her first husband through a deeper faith and closer relationship with the Holy Spirit to her marriage and sharing ministry with James, an Army chaplain (now retired).

Most of the books I’ve written are listed on the Books page of this site. One nonfiction book about network marketing is now out of print.
Getting published can be very tough. There was a survey several years ago that showed romance authors wrote an average 7 books and had been writing for an average of 7 years before they made their first sale. Most writers have one or more “practice” books they use to learn the craft.
However, anyone can self-publish their own work. Unfortunately that means there are a lot of really bad books self-published every year so the good ones have a hard time getting noticed.
